This abstract first appeared for US patent application 20240337431 titled 'STOREHOUSE
The present disclosure pertains to a storehouse with a first storage space for goods at a specific temperature and a second storage space for a heat exchanger. A tray collects fluid from the second space, which is connected to the first space.
- Storehouse with two storage spaces - one for goods at a set temperature and one for a heat exchanger
- Tray collects fluid from the second space
- Fluid connection between the two storage spaces

Original Abstract Submitted
the present disclosure relates to a storehouse. in one aspect of the present disclosure, a storehouse may include a first storage space configured to provide a space in which goods are stored within a predetermined temperature or a predetermined temperature range and a second storage space configured to provide a space in which a first heat exchanger is accommodated. the storehouse may include a tray provided adjacent to the second wall defining at least a part of the second storage space and forming a fluid collecting portion configured to store a fluid discharged from the second wall. the second storage space may be fluidly connected to the first storage space.
